Meghan Markle and Prince Harry Secure £3m Novel Rights to Revive Hollywood Dream.

Meghan Markle and Prince Harry have made a significant move in their quest to revive their Hollywood dreams by acquiring the rights to a multi-million-pound novel.

The Duke and Duchess of Sussex purchased the rights to the romantic book, “Meet Me At The Lake,” penned by Carley Fortune.

The acquisition of the novel is estimated to have cost around £3 million, but it presents a promising opportunity for the couple to make their mark in Hollywood once again.

This venture will mark their first collaboration behind the scenes.

Following their departure from royal duties (Megxit), this decision could prove to be a pivotal moment in their careers. The novel, “Meet Me At The Lake,” proved immensely popular, with an impressive 37,000 copies sold within just the first week of its release.

The story revolves around two individuals in their 30s who find love in each other’s company.

Interestingly, parts of the novel appear to resonate with Prince Harry, as it touches on the emotional turmoil faced by a character who lost a parent in a tragic car crash during childhood.

 Furthermore, themes of drug and alcohol use, also covered by the Duke in his memoir “Spare,” find their way into the narrative of the book.

An insider revealed that the novel’s compelling themes captured the couple’s interest and prompted them to select it as their first adaptation for Netflix.

Despite their plans for production, the Hollywood entertainment industry is currently facing a strike by screenwriters and actors, which may persist for several months.

Nonetheless, this venture could be an opportunity for Meghan and Harry to rebuild their careers, especially after their partnership with Swedish streaming service Spotify ended.

Meghan had previously hosted her Archetype podcast on the platform, but the show was not renewed.

Meanwhile, Prince Harry is actively working on a series centered around the Paralympic-style Invictus Games, titled “Heart of Invictus,” expected to be released on Netflix later this year.
